首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将每日数据转换为每月,并以pandas为单位获取月份的最新值

,可以通过以下步骤实现:

  1. 首先,将每日数据加载到一个pandas的DataFrame中。假设数据已经存储在一个名为daily_data的DataFrame中,其中包含两列:日期(Date)和数值(Value)。
  2. 将日期列(Date)转换为pandas的日期时间格式,以便后续操作。可以使用pd.to_datetime()函数实现,例如:daily_data['Date'] = pd.to_datetime(daily_data['Date'])
  3. 使用pandas的resample()函数将每日数据转换为每月数据。将日期列(Date)设置为索引后,可以使用resample()函数按月进行重采样,并指定聚合函数(例如,求和、平均值等)。假设需要获取每月的最新值,则可以使用resample('M').last()。具体代码如下:
  4. 使用pandas的resample()函数将每日数据转换为每月数据。将日期列(Date)设置为索引后,可以使用resample()函数按月进行重采样,并指定聚合函数(例如,求和、平均值等)。假设需要获取每月的最新值,则可以使用resample('M').last()。具体代码如下:
  5. 最后,获取每月的最新值。可以通过访问monthly_data的数值列(Value)来获取每月的最新值。例如,可以使用monthly_data['Value']来获取每月的最新值。

综上所述,通过以上步骤,可以将每日数据转换为每月,并以pandas为单位获取月份的最新值。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券